#3dc113 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3dc113 is composed of 23.9% red, 75.7%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.2%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 105.5 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 41.6%. #3dc113 color hex could be obtained by blending #7aff26 with #008300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#3dc113

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050e01 is the darkest color, while #fcf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3dc113

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676f65 is the less saturated color, while #35d103 is the most saturated one.
